The ingredients needed to make Cheesy Tortilla Chips:
- Prepare 5 tortillas
- Get 1 egg white
- Take 1/2 tsp cayenne pepper
- Take 1/2 cup shredded cheese of your liking, Colby jack and cheddar work well
- Make ready 1/2 tbsp jalapeños, finely chopped.

Instructions to make Cheesy Tortilla Chips:
- Preheat oven to 425°F.
- Beat the egg white in a small bowl, lightly brush tortilla with egg white. I fix these right in the baking sheet or pizza stone for easy cleanup
- Sprinkle tortilla with cayenne pepper, add cheese, then jalapeño.
- Cut each tortilla into eighths, and arrange on baking sheet/stone.
- Bake for 5-10 minutes or until cheese is melted. Run a pizza cutter through previous cuts to slice through cheese ***Note I added a bit too much cheese which made them a little soggy so I let them cool to the touch, rearranged again, then popped back into the oven for a nice crunchy chip.
- Serve alone, with salsa, or your favorite dip…..Enjoy!!!
